Oman produced oil at an average rate of 885,600 barrrels a day in January, up 4.2 per cent from the previous month, state-run Oman News Agency reported on Sunday.
The Arab country exported more than 7.23 million barrels of crude oil in January, for an increase of 17 per cent over January 2010, the agency reported on its website. Oman pumped 98,903m cubic feet of gas last month, 7.4 per cent more than in the prior year, ONA said
